Full Legislative History
Resolution Number: 1994-B101
Title: Pastoral Study Document on Sexuality
Legislative Action Taken: Adopted
Final Text:

Resolved, That the House of Bishops, affirming the teaching of the Church that the normative context for sexual intimacy is lifelong, heterosexual, monogamous marriage, and pursuing our Anglican tradition of historic truth encountering contemporary life, offers Continuing the Dialogue: A Pastoral Study Document of the House of Bishops to the Church as the Church Considers Issues of Human Sexuality to the Church as a way for the Church to continue the dialogue on human sexuality; and be it further

Resolved, That the two statements, "An Affirmation" and "An Affirmation in Koinonia," not be an official part of the House of Bishops' Pastoral Study Document on human sexuality; the statements are to be made a part of the minutes with names of signatories attached, but not distributed with the study document.

Citation: General Convention, Journal of the General Convention of...The Episcopal Church, Indianapolis, 1994 (New York: General Convention, 1995), pp. 141-42.
